WEIRD ON TOP: SOME LYNCH STUFF



20th October sees the release of two DVDs which will delight David Lynch buffs. First of all, ERASERHEAD which will include an 86 minute interview with Lynch about the making of this film.


THE SHORT FILMS OF DAVID LYNCH is a collection of six films (all introduced by Lynch): SIX MEN GETTING SICK: 1 minute film projected onto sculptured screen. THE ALPHABET: 16mm 4 minutes. THE GRANDMOTHER: 16mm 34 minutes. THE AMPUTEE: Video - 2 versions 5 minutes/4 minutes. THE COWBOY AND THE FRENCHMAN: 35mm 26 minutes.LUMIERE: 35mm 55 seconds using original Lumiere Brothers camera.


ERASERHEAD will retail for around £11.99, while the short films are just under a tenner. Two essential releases. I've yet to see the shorts, and it will be nice to see Lynch's debut feature again with optimum picture quality.
